Job description

Senior Electrical Engineer - Los Angeles, CA (Finance)
The Opportunity:

Glumac, a Tetra Tech company, is adding a Senior Electrical Engineer to our team in Los Angeles, CA.

Position Summary:

We are seeking a highly motivated Senior Electrical Engineer to lead the design and delivery of innovative electrical systems for complex building projects. With a strong technical foundation and a collaborative mindset, you'll play a critical role in transforming concepts into safe, efficient, and sustainable buildings.

As a senior member of our engineering team, you will provide technical leadership, guide project teams, and serve as a trusted advisor to clients, architects, and construction partners. From healthcare facilities and higher education campuses to commercial developments and mission-critical infrastructure, you will help deliver successful solutions that inspire our clients.

Essential Job Functions:

The following duties are considered essential to the role.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form these essential functions:

  • Mentor and develop junior engineers and designers.
  • Drive project execution from concept through construction administration.
  • Establish and maintain engineering standards, best practices, and quality control procedures.
  • Collaborate with Project Managers on budgeting, scheduling, and staff management.
  • Act as the Engineer of Record, leading technical communication with clients.
  • Collaborate with owners, architects, contractors, and regulatory agencies to achieve successful project outcomes.
  • Participate in recruitment and retention efforts, ensuring a strong engineering team.
  • Support and refine Glumac's technical standards, implementing best practices in the local office.
  • Support business development efforts through client engagement, proposal development, and industry leadership.
Required Qualifications:
  • 10+ years of experience as an MEP Engineer in infrastructure and/or building systems.
  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ering.
  • Current Professional Engineering (PE) license is required.
  • Working experience with building and electrical codes.
  • Experience managing staff as a direct supervisor.
  • Revit experience.
  • Applicants must be currently authorized to work in the United States on a full-time basis; this position is not eligible for current or future employment visa sponsorship.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Strong background in sustainable design is highly desirable.
  • LEED AP BD+C accreditation.
  • WELL certification.
Work Environment and Location:

This position offers a hybrid work environment, with a requirement of two in-office days per week in our Los Angeles, CA office. All candidates must be located in and eligible to work in the U.S.

Why Glumac, a Tetra Tech Company:

Glumac has been a leader in the sustainable building design industry for over 50 years. In 2017 we joined Tetra Tech, enabling us to combine our expertise with the reach and resources of a prestigious global organization.

About Tetra Tech:

Tetra Tech is the leader in water, environment, and sustainable infrastructure, providing high-end consulting and engineering services for projects worldwide. Our 25,000 employees work together to provide clear solutions to complex problems by Leading with Science to address the entire water cycle, protect and restore the environment, design sustainable and resilient infrastructure, and support the clean energy transition.
